#### 13. To avoid blocking in loop when WiFi is lost
#### 13.1 Max times to try WiFi per loop
To define max times to try WiFi per loop() iteration. To avoid blocking issue in loop()
Default is 1 if not defined, and minimum is forced to be 1.
To use, uncomment in `defines.h`.
Check [retries block the main loop #18](https://github.com/khoih-prog/WiFiManager_NINA_Lite/issues/18#issue-1094004380)
```
#define MAX_NUM_WIFI_RECON_TRIES_PER_LOOP 2
```
#### 13.2 Interval between reconnection WiFi if lost
Default is no interval between reconnection WiFi times if lost WiFi. Max permitted interval will be 10mins.
Uncomment to use. Be careful, WiFi reconnection will be delayed if using this method.
Only use whenever urgent tasks in loop() can't be delayed. But if so, it's better you have to rewrite your code, e.g. using higher priority tasks.
Check [retries block the main loop #18](https://github.com/khoih-prog/WiFiManager_NINA_Lite/issues/18#issuecomment-1006197561)
```
#define WIFI_RECON_INTERVAL 30000 // 30s
```

### Release v1.7.0

1. Fix ESP8266 bug not easy to connect to Config Portal for ESP8266 core v3.0.0+
2. Fix the blocking issue in loop(). Check [retries block the main loop #18](https://github.com/khoih-prog/WiFiManager_NINA_Lite/issues/18)
3. Configurable `WIFI_RECON_INTERVAL`. Check [retries block the main loop #18](https://github.com/khoih-prog/WiFiManager_NINA_Lite/issues/18#issuecomment-1006197561)
4. Clean up
